General
Sim Type | Single Sim, GSM | Single Sim, GSM |
Dual Sim | No | No |
Sim Size | Nano SIM | |
Device Type | Smartphone | Smartphone |
Release Date | May, 2015 | August, 2009 |
Design
Dimensions | 72 x 146 x 6.9 mm | 59.8 x 110.9 x 18 mm |
Weight | 144 g | 181 g |
Design Type | Slider | |
Qwerty | Yes |
Display
Type | Color IPS Screen (16M colors Colors) | Color TFT Screen (65K colors Colors) |
Touch | Yes | Yes, Resistive |
Size | 5.2 inches, 1080 x 1920 pixels | 3.5 inches, 800 x 480 pixels |
Aspect Ratio | 16:9 | 5:3 |
PPI | ~ 424 PPI | ~ 267 PPI |
Features | Scratch-resistant glass, oleophobic coating Screen Protection |
Memory
Phonebook | Unlimited | |
RAM | 3 GB | 256 MB |
Storage | 32 GB | 32 GB |
Card Slot | Yes, upto 128 GB | Yes, upto 16 GB |
Connectivity
GPRS | Yes | Yes |
EDGE | Yes | Yes |
3G | Yes | Yes 10 Mbps Download 2 Mbps Upload |
4G | Yes | |
Wifi | Yes, with wifi-hotspot | Yes, with wifi-hotspot |
Bluetooth | Yes, v4.1 | Yes, v2.1 |
USB | Yes, microUSB-MHL v2.0 | Yes, microUSB v2.0 |
USB Features | USB on-the-go | USB Charging |
Extra
GPS | Yes, with A-GPS Support | Yes, with A-GPS Support |
Sensors | Accelerometer, Gyroscope, Compass | Accelerometer |
3.5mm Headphone Jack | Yes | Yes |
NFC | Yes | |
Extra | HDMI, DLNA, TV Out | DLNA, TV Out |
Camera
Rear Camera | 20.7 MP with autofocus | 5 MP with autofocus |
Features | Face detection, Geo tagging, Panorama, Touch to focus | Geo tagging |
Video Recording | 4K @ 30 fps UHD | 848 x 480 px @ 25 fps |
Flash | Yes, LED | Yes, Dual LED |
Front Camera | 5.09 MP | 0.07 MP |
Technical
OS | Android v5.0 (Lollipop) | Maemo v5 |
Chipset | Qualcomm Snapdragon 810 | |
CPU | 1.5 GHz, Octa Core Processor | 600 MHz, Single Core Processor |
GPU | Adreno 430 | |
Java | No | No |
Browser | Yes, supports HTML | Yes, supports HTML/Flash |
Multimedia
Supports | MMS, Instant Messaging | Instant Messaging, Voice Recording, Calendar |
Yes, with Push Email | Yes | |
Music | MP3, eAAC+, WAV | MP3, AAC, AAC+, eAAC+, WMA, WAV, M4A (Apple lossless) |
Video | MP4 | MPEG4, H.263, H.264, XviD, WMV |
FM Radio | Yes | Yes |
Document Reader | Yes | Yes |
Battery
Type | Non-Removable Battery | Removable Battery |
Size | 2930 mAh, Li-ion Battery | 1320 mAh, Li-ion Battery |
StandBy Time | 24 days | 11 days |
Talk Time | 12 hours | 390 min |
Music Playback Time | 91 hours | 24 hours |
